I woke up naturally early in the morning, packed up, and drove to the Main Buddhist Temple.

It's said that over a thousand years ago, the Mengle Palace of Xishuangbanna was built near Mandou Village, Mangge Community, Yunjinghong Sub-district Office. At that time, this area was a key political district in Xishuangbanna. Many temples in this area moved away, but only Wazhuangde Buddhist Temple remained, serving Buddhist believers in Jinghongjiangbei (north bank of the Lancang River). It wasn't until Buddhist temples were built in Dai villages north of Jinghongjiangbei that Wazhuangde Temple gradually declined. The stone pillars of the main hall of Wazhuangde Buddhist Temple are still preserved within the ruins. It was rebuilt in 2016 with the help of the Buddhist Association. Wazhuangde Buddhist Temple is a key Buddhist temple for the Dai and Leu believers in Xishuangbanna, and Princess Sirindhorn of Thailand even donated to the Main Buddhist Temple.

Coming out of the Imperial Garden, it was already noon, so I found a Dai-style restaurant nearby.

Since it wasn't a good time to go out on such a rainy day, we pulled out our tea set, boiled some water, turned on some music, and pulled out our phones to organize our photos and make a video. It was a peaceful and beautiful afternoon.

At 6 p.m., the rain stopped, the sky cleared, and we drove to Gaozhuang Starry Sky Night Market again. We wanted to see the Six Nations Floating Market. After asking around, we learned that the Mekong River Floating Market was no longer in existence, replaced by a wooden boardwalk-style market and a Six Nations concert. We ordered some teppanyaki and juice there, and enjoyed the fireworks of Banna after the epidemic in the hustle and bustle!
